Weed Yuan's afterthought Day48:

The three-choice love story is a mystery drama. With the story that the girl Maya's father told her, we are also constantly guessing who Maya's mother is. It's a pity that we all seem to guess wrong like Maya at the beginning, but fortunately the ending of the story is beautiful. But in reality, there are probably only a handful of them.

Lovers, wives, loved ones, maybe many people go round and round when they meet the original person, the ending is often that they are married to each other or the other party is married, as in the film, the probability is really too small.

Especially about the last love, many are usually forced to get married and have children due to the helplessness of reality, and few have been waiting until the end.

Movies will always bring us a lot of seemingly different lives. Let us also experience their lives with the actors, watch more beautiful things, and become better ourselves.
